SANTA CRUZ DE TENERIFE, 10 Apr. (EUROPE PRESS) –
The National Police have arrested three men of German origin for a crime of drug trafficking by selling narcotic substances such as marijuana and hashish illegally in an establishment in the town of Adeje.
National Police agents specialized in the investigation of drug trafficking crimes were able to verify that the establishment, under an alleged activity as a cannabis association, received a constant influx of people who turned out to be tourists without registering with the association.
During this period, the police detected the sale of narcotic substances to people of foreign origin who, during their vacation stay and lacking the registration card as a member required in this type of premises, entered the association to buy marijuana and hashish leaving a few minutes after.
Once the investigations were advanced, the establishment was immediately entered and searched under the authorization of the competent court, seizing more than 12,000 euros in cash, a pressing machine, more than two and a half kilos of marijuana and close to others. two kilos of hashish, as well as more than two hundred cigarettes also containing a narcotic substance inside.
The two officials who were on the premises and the president of the association were arrested, and they were turned over to the competent judicial authority.
